7 Master's degrees offered by the university
Industrial Engineering and Operations Research
This one-year Industrial Engineering and Operations Research program from MINES Saint-Étienne deals with applications of advanced techniques of industrial engineering and operations research to decision making, especially scientific methods for modeling, performance evaluation, design, production planning and scheduling, supply chain management and maintenance of both manufacturing.
Hybrid Electronics
Follow a one-year Master program in Hybrid Electronics from MINES Saint-Étienne that hosts world-renowned Professors and Research Scientists heading research laboratories in the field of Nanotechnology and Materials Science (University of California San Diego, University of Pisa, Technion-Israël Instute of Technology, University of Western Ontario…).
Process Engineering and Industrial Energy Efficiency
This Process Engineering and Industrial Energy Efficiency program from MINES Saint-Étienne is also partly focused on the study of industrial processes in relation with solid reactions (particles, powders, granular and porous media): studies ranging from micro to macro scale “From particles to processes”.
Mathematical Imaging and Spatial Pattern Analysis
The Mathematical Imaging and Spatial Pattern Analysis program from MINES Saint-Étienne is a specific track of Master’s degree in Optics, Image, Vision, Multimedia and leads to the award of the French national diploma of Master in Optics, Image, Vision, Multimedia (OIVM).
Materials Science Engineering
The Materials Science Engineering master from MINES Saint-Étienne is a one-year program taught entirely in English. It offers advanced-level courses in the field of physical metallurgy with strong emphasis on comprehension and physically-based modeling of phenomena at the origin of properties of modern materials (metals, ceramics, …).
BioMedical Engineering and Design
Skills and knowledge connected to the activities of R&D in the biomedical sector are the main targets of the BioMedical Engineering and Design program from MINES Saint-Étienne.
Cyber-Physical Social Systems
The aim of this Cyber-Physical Social Systems program from MINES Saint-Étienne is to provide students with strong expertise on Artificial Intelligence and Internet of Things to develop theoretical models and technologies for current and future applications in industry and society.
